Tenrikyo Scriptures
The Ofudesaki, the Mikagura-uta and the Osashizu are called the "Three Scriptures", books which contain God the Parent's direct teachings and revelations. The Tenrikyo teachings are based on these Scriptures.

The Ofudesaki was written by Oyasama who personally took up Her writing brush to record the teachings. |
The Mikagura-uta was taught personally by Oyasama as the songs to accompany the Service. |
The Osashizu is the collected transcriptions of God the Parent's verbal directions given through Oyasama and the Honseki, Izo Iburi. |

The Shinbashiras' Books
The Shinbashira is the spiritual and administrative leader of Tenrikyo.
